The Pancreas: Your Body's Hidden Powerhouse
Nestled in your abdomen, behind the stomach, the pancreas works quietly to support daily vitality. It releases digestive enzymes to break down proteins, fats, and carbohydrates in your small intestine. At the same time, it produces hormones like insulin and glucagon to maintain steady blood sugar levels. When balanced, it ensures nutrients reach your cells and energy flows smoothly. Key Nutrients for Pancreas Health
Certain foods and nutrients stand out for supporting pancreas function:
- Antioxidants: Protect against inflammation. Blueberries, cherries, and red grapes provide compounds that shield pancreatic cells.
- Probiotics: Foster gut balance, which influences pancreas health via the microbiome. Yogurt or kefir with live cultures help.
- Fiber-rich foods: Slow sugar absorption for stable blood levels. Oats, sweet potatoes, and broccoli are gentle choices.
- Lean proteins: Ease digestion without overload. Fish, chicken, beans, and tofu supply building blocks without excess fat.
- Healthy fats: Medium-chain types like in coconut oil support enzyme production without taxing the pancreas.
- Vitamins and minerals: Vitamin D combats deficiencies common in pancreas issues; magnesium aids insulin sensitivity. Leafy greens like spinach and mushrooms deliver these.
Avoid fried foods, alcohol, and refined sugars, which burden the pancreas and spike inflammation.
